Definitely Haunted for Printables and Digital Workbooks

For creators who rely on printables and digital workbooks, Definitely Haunted offers a fresh alternative to typical display fonts. I recently used it in a printable planner designed for fans of the supernatural, and it brought a sense of whimsy and creativity to the layout. The font’s distinct style made each page feel like a small story waiting to be discovered.

However, it’s important to consider readability when using Definitely Haunted in longer-form content. While it excels in headlines and titles, it may not be suitable for dense paragraphs or small captions. That said, its expressive nature makes it a perfect match for chapter openers, call-out boxes, and other elements that require a bit of flair without sacrificing clarity.

Definitely Haunted for Web and Mobile Layouts

With the rise of digital publishing, it’s essential to consider how fonts perform across different platforms. Definitely Haunted is available in multiple weights and styles, making it adaptable for web and mobile layouts. I tested it in a responsive newsletter template and was pleased with how it rendered on both desktop and mobile devices.

While the font’s decorative elements can sometimes affect readability on smaller screens, careful spacing and sizing adjustments can ensure it remains legible. It’s also worth noting that Definitely Haunted supports multilingual characters, which is a valuable feature for international audiences or content creators working with diverse languages.

Before using Definitely Haunted in commercial projects, always check the included styles, ligatures, and file formats to ensure compatibility with your design workflow. Proper licensing is crucial, especially if you’re planning to use the font in paid newsletters, client publications, or digital downloads.
